What Happened
Dhoot Transmission's IPO allotment is anticipated today, with market observers noting a Grey Market Premium (GMP) of ₹276. This substantial premium suggests strong investor appetite for the company's shares, indicating a high probability of a positive listing on the stock exchanges.
Why It Matters (for you)
A strong GMP for an IPO is a key indicator of market sentiment towards new listings and often translates into significant listing gains for investors. This event is particularly noteworthy as it occurs when the broader Indian market (Nifty, Sensex) has shown some recent weakness, highlighting that quality IPOs can still command premium valuations.
